Kratom Tincture

A kratom tincture is another option if you are looking for a kratom liquid form. The creation process is what distinguishes a tincture from a liquid extract.

Kratom tincture can be made by soaking the plant with a solvent (typically alcohol) and then removing the solid particles. It is helpful to review the recipes for herbal tinctures. A typical recipe for a herbal tincture is to take the leaves and chop them finely before placing them in an airtight container. They would then pour alcohol into the container. The freshness of the kratom leaves would determine how much alcohol they add to the container. Fresh leaves can be used to make a 1:1 solution. One ounce of kratom per ounce of alcohol. This recipe requires a 1 to 4 solution if the leaves have been dried.

The alcohol is added to the jar. Once sealed, allow the alcohol to sit for at least six weeks. This gives the alcohol time and energy to absorb the active ingredients in the kratom. After enough time, strain the solution and place the liquid in a dropper.

Because of its relative ease of use and effectiveness, a person would make a kratom tincture. A dropper is a faster and more efficient way to measure kratom than having to weigh it and portion it out.

The Three Parts Of A Dental Implant

Simply explained, dental implants, which look like screws or cylinders and are made of medical-grade titanium, are replacements for missing tooth roots.

They are made to look like natural teeth and are utilized as a strong foundation for either removable replacement teeth or permanent, fixed teeth. A dental implant is made up of three fundamental components: the fixture, the abutment, and the dental prosthesis.

  • The fixture which gets implanted in and bonded with a patient’s jawbone serves as the implant’s artificial root.
  • The abutment, which is the component of the implant that is above and at the gum line, attaches and supports a crown, denture, bridge, or another form of dental treatment that is placed on it.
  • The dental prosthesis fits on top of the abutment and functions similarly to a natural tooth. It can be snapped or clipped (for dentures), screwed, or glued (for bridgework or crowns).

Prevents The Remaining Teeth From Shifting

When you lose a tooth, a gap is formed, which causes bone loss. The teeth that remain adjacent to the gap begin to move as a result of natural stress and mouth forces. As a result, your straight, healthy teeth become unstable.

This condition can result in more bone loss as well as tooth loss. These problems, however, can be avoided by correcting gaps with dental implants.

How to get a Maryland medical marijuana card?

Many residents who meet the criteria have applied for a medical marijuana card in order to legally purchase these products.

Registering for medical marijuana in Maryland is simple if you have the proper paperwork and a licensed physician available to evaluate your condition. Here is a step-by-step guide to obtaining your Maryland cannabis card.

Step 1: Apply to the Maryland medical cannabis commission

In contrast to many other states, Maryland requires you to register with the medical cannabis commission (MCC) before visiting a doctor for an evaluation. You must register for an account on the mmcc registration portal and provide the following information:

• A driver’s license or passport as proof of identity;

• Two pieces of documentation proving your Maryland residencies, such as a utility bill, bank statement, or a mva registration card; and

• A clear, electronic copy of a recent photograph.

Visit the Doctors of Cannabis website for a complete list of the documents you must provide, as well as guidelines for your photograph and proof of residency. To validate your account, you must verify your email address after creating an account and submitting an application.

The MCC will then review your application and notify you via email if it is approved. Save this approval email for your records as it contains important information for your registration.

Step 2: Obtain a written certification from an MCC-accredited physician

After completing your initial registration and receiving approval, you can now consult with a licensed physician who can provide you with written certification for medical cannabis use. Not every Maryland doctor is eligible; you must see a provider who is registered with the MCC.

The sanctuary wellness institute can put you in touch with a physician who has the necessary credentials to evaluate your qualifying condition. If your doctor clears you to use cannabis, you will be given a valid written certification.

Step 3: Finish your MCC registration

Your doctor will request your patient id number, which was included in your MCC approval email, and will issue the certification via the MCC’s online portal. You can now complete your mmcc registration with your certification on file.

Step 4: Buy medical marijuana from a licensed dispensary.

With your temporary MMC id in hand, you can buy cannabis from any licensed dispensary in Maryland. When you visit a dispensary, the staff will ask you to show your MCC id card so that your information can be verified in the state’s database.

You can buy medical marijuana for up to 30 days at a time. Furthermore, you must begin purchasing cannabis within 120 days of receiving your certification, or it will be rendered null and void.

Cognitive Behavioral Therapy ForAnxiety Disorders

C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T), one of the most popular therapies for anxiety disorders, is CBT. CBT helps patients understand what triggers anxiety, and how to respond. CBT focuses on the patient’s thoughts and behavior, as well as how they can cope with anxiety-triggering situations.

Exposure Therapy For Anxiety Disorders

Exposure therapy is a controlled environment where patients are slowly exposed to situations that could normally cause anxiety. Exposure therapy is the gradual desensitization of patients to trigger situations until they are no longer triggering. The patient experiences fewer panic attacks and anxiety over time.

1. Constant Medical Supervision

The vast majority of people in detox will suffer withdrawal symptoms. These symptoms can range from moderate to severe, with some individuals developing seizures. Because of the possibility of fatal symptoms, it is critical to detox at a facility that has medical specialists on-site 24 hours a day, seven days a week. Choosing a detox center that provides high medical care can make the process safer, and more likely to be effective.

2. Routine And Structure

Another significant advantage of inpatient therapy is the structure and regularity that these programs offer. Inpatient treatment programs include therapy groups and individual sessions to help patients cope with the psychological difficulties associated with the detox process. Patients are also given resources like relapse prevention planning guides and information on the illness model of addiction. Having a feeling of community among peers who are going through similar problems frequently helps to affirm and support a patient’s experience.

3. Eliminating Common Triggers

Inpatient detox programs provide patients a drug- and alcohol-free setting in which they can safely transition to a life in recovery. Many people identify certain activities or places with drug/alcohol use, thus the chance to develop initial recovery skills in a setting free of those associations typically sets someone up for long-term recovery success.
